A sporting goods store pays $170 for a rubber raft. The percent of markup is 45%. Find the raft’s selling price.

So as the statement said, the sporting goods store pays $170 so it means that it is equal to 100%, now since it is gonna sell the item with 45% markup, it means that it will be added to the 100% so you'll get 145% of $170. After multiply $170 by 145% to get the answer $246.50. The sporting goods store will sell the rubber raft at $246.50.
